What is a church AV technician?

Church AV (Audio-Visual) technicians are professionals responsible for managing and operating the audio, video, and lighting systems in a church setting. Their duties include setting up microphones, speakers, projectors, and cameras for worship services, live streams, and events. They ensure that sound and visuals are clear and enhance the congregation's experience without distractions. Church AV technicians also troubleshoot technical issues and may train volunteers to assist with equipment. Their role is essential for both in-person and online church engagement.

Job description

Woodside Bible Church is seeking a Systems Engineer to maintain all production systems within the Worship Center at the Troy Campus. This role ensures that audio, video, and lighting systems are fully functional, optimized, and ready to support excellent, distraction-free worship experiences.

The Systems Engineer partners closely with Production staff to prepare systems, support events, and provide training for staff and volunteers. This individual also plays a key role in system improvements, vendor coordination, and the implementation of new technologies, while actively contributing to production environments on a regular basis.

  • Maintain and optimize audio, video, and lighting systems for all Worship Center events
  • Ensure systems are fully prepared and functioning with excellence each week
  • Partner with Production leadership on stage turns, system upgrades, and improvements
  • Manage vendor relationships and oversee technical projects
  • Develop documentation and standard operating procedures for all systems
  • Train and equip staff and volunteers to effectively use production systems
  • Provide hands-on Sunday morning production support (audio, video, lighting, or stage management) at least monthly
What We’re Looking For:
  • Experience in live production environments with strong technical expertise
  • Knowledge of complex AV systems, including Dante, LED walls, and media servers
  • Strong troubleshooting skills and ability to perform under pressure
  • A collaborative, team-oriented mindset with strong communication skills
  • Passion for learning new technologies and improving systems
  • A spiritually mature individual aligned with Woodside’s mission and values
